WebSince Shelley is influenced by the early Romantics like William Coleridge, William Wordsworth and her husband Percy Shelley, (“Romanticism”, 2010) the writer of Frankenstein uses the nature as a therapy or restorative agent that always helps Victor to regain his strength from. Victor restores his mental and physical strength which was ...
